NFL scouts lift considerations about USC QB Caleb Williams

Day it kind of feels a for the reason that the Chicago Bears will manufacture USC Trojans quarterback Caleb Williams the primary select of the 2024 NFL Draft at the night time of April 25, questions proceed to be raised relating to whether or not Williams generally is a chief of a profitable professional group.

For a work printed Wednesday, And Pompeii of The Athletic shared that “eight NFL talent evaluators” ranked Williams 6th out of six quarterback possibilities because it relates to intangibles and immeasurables.

“Four of the eight scouts rated Williams last overall in immeasurables and three rated him next to last,” Pompei defined. “…Williams has been criticized for painting his fingernails and crying in his mother’s arms in the stands after USC lost to Washington. That raised questions about his toughness.”

As just lately as Tuesday, ESPN NFL insider Jeremy Fowler observable that some groups had been additionally became off through how Williams finished negative clinical critiques on the scouting mix and through how he allegedly handled the mix “as if he were visiting a real estate open house.” One scout instructed Pompei that Williams used to be “difficult to deal with at the combine.”

“It wasn’t easy trying to get information on him,” that scout added about Williams. “You had to dig. Everyone tries to protect him, which leads you to wonder what they are trying to hide. If he has been banged up, we don’t know.”

There’s these days negative signal that the Bears have any considerations about Williams’ character even supposing Chicago cornerback Jaylon Johnson warned in March that the to-be rookie “can’t bring that Hollywood stuff into the building.” One scout discussed that the belief exists that Williams has loved a “red-carpet runway experience at every stop and hasn’t had much to overcome.” Williams clapped again at such takes extreme date.

“I think his toughness has yet to be determined,” that scout instructed Pompei. “…But when you end up sobbing in your mom’s arms after getting beat, that’s a disqualifier for people who aren’t picking in the top few picks.”

For what it’s use, a couple of scouts famous that teammates and the power professor at USC “have nothing but great things to say about” Williams and raved concerning the quarterback’s paintings ethic. In the meantime, ESPN analysts Louis Riddick and Dan Orlovsky have publicly mentioned they consider Jayden Daniels of the LSU Tigers is “the best quarterback” within the after draft.

Will any of this subject? Most likely now not. As of Wednesday afternoon, DraftKings Sportsbook indexed Williams as the overpowering making a bet favourite at -10000 odds to be the draft’s first selection. Daniels used to be 2nd at the checklist at +2000 odds.
